R451 PJB is a 1998 Volkswagen Golf in Blue with a 1,900c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 1998 Volkswagen Golf models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.1% with a typical mileage of 100,017 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Volkswagen Golf f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 700,382 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R451 PJB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volkswagen Golf typ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 28 years old, this Volkswagen Golf is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
